CEBU CITY, Philippines -- The Capitol has encouraged law enforcement units in the province to institute stricter security measures in ports following the daring mall robbery in Mandaue City last

Garcia said Colonel Roderick Mariano, CPPO director, had already assured her that the police would be working to put measures in place to deter the entry of lawless individuals in the province.Board Member Thadeo Jovito Ouano, Provincial Board’s chairman on the Committee on Public Safety, Security and Dangerous Drugs Abuse Prevention, earlier encouraged Cebuanos to be vigilant on new migrants in their communities.

Ouano said the residents should report to the police, for monitoring purposes, their new neighbors especially if they would engage in suspicious activities. Ouano also said he planne to introduce an ordinance that would require establishments to hire security personnel in light of the incident.The comments uploaded on this site do not necessarily represent or reflect the views of management and owner of Cebudailynews.
